Adventures in Music is a fun and engaging class where caregivers and children can explore music side by side through singing, movement, and playful music-making. Each week is full of songs, chants, finger plays, bounces, listening games, and movement activities designed to spark joy and creativity.
Together, families enjoy circle dances, instrument play, and musical stories that encourage children to move expressively, sing confidently, and explore sound in new ways. We’ll introduce simple percussion instruments that help build rhythmic skills and begin using instruments that develop fine motor control. Children also start exploring more complex songs with wider vocal ranges and patterns that build pitch-matching and listening skills.
Here’s what your child can look forward to:
- Playing age-appropriate percussion instruments to build rhythmic confidence and a steady beat.
- Simple solo singing to strengthen pitch matching and listening.
- Movement activities that support both fine and gross motor development.
- Expressive movement to build spatial awareness and body control.
- A growing collection of fun songs and musical games.
- The opportunity to share musical ideas—a first step toward improvisation.
Each session includes 45 minutes of guided musical activities and 15 minutes of Community Time — a chance to talk with our expert teachers, ask questions, connect with other families, and enjoy free playtime for the kids.
This class is designed for children who are age 3 as of September 2025 and includes active participation from a caregiver.
